Wimborne Orienteers (WIM) will be hosting our South‑West CompassSport Trophy qualifying round at Affpuddle, near Dorchester, on Sunday 22 February 2026. This is the main national inter‑club competition for clubs like QO, with juniors, seniors and veterans all contributing to the overall team score.

It’s a brilliant club day out in quality forest terrain: everyone runs a normal colour‑coded course, but your run also scores points for QO against other South‑West clubs. You don’t need to be fast or very experienced – a big turnout of QO vests is what really makes the difference and creates a great club atmosphere.
